Which of the following would not be a belief of a retributivist?
A) Punishing some innocent people is a price of general deterrence.
B) Offenders are paying a debt to society.
C) Offenders have taken unfair advantage of others.
D) Punishment is a censure of offenders.
Retributivist
A theory of punishment that justifies penalizing wrongdoers on the basis that they deserve punishment commensurate with the harm they have caused.
General Deterrence
is a theory in criminology that suggests the prevention of criminal behavior through the threat of punishment, aiming to discourage others from committing similar offenses.
Punishing Innocent
The act of subjecting individuals who have not committed any wrongdoing to punishment.
